    After getting to three wins in a playoff series, Heat has 13-3 record in the next game during the last four playoff years.

    Read more here: https://www.miamiherald.com/2014/05/28/4141782/miami-heat-eager-to-close-out.html#storylink=cpy

    Two of the Heat’s three closeout game losses prevented only a sweep and extended each series by just one game.

    Breakdown of those records

    At home  9-0 su and 6-3 ats
    Away      4-3 su and 4-3 ats

    Take it for what it s worth.
